Amazon Q Developer
If you work within the AWS ecosystem, another strong contender among top AI coding tools is Amazon Q Developer (formerly CodeWhisperer). It provides inline code suggestions and completions as you type, similar to other AI assistants, but its real standout feature is built-in security scanning. As you write code, Amazon Q Developer automatically scans for security vulnerabilities and offers suggested patches, helping you catch issues early without needing a separate tool. This makes it a practical choice for developers who want both productivity boosts and security checks in one place. It integrates natively with all AWS tools and services, so if you already use AWS Lambda, Amazon S3, or other services, the suggestions are contextually relevant to your environment. Amazon Q Developer supports 15 programming languages including Python, Java, C#, and SQL, covering a wide range of projects. Perhaps best of all, it is free for individual developers, making it an accessible entry point for anyone looking to explore AI-assisted coding without upfront cost.

What Gemini Can Do for Android Developers
Gemini goes beyond simple autocomplete. It can generate code snippets for common patterns, suggest fixes for lint warnings, and even help you understand error messages. For example, if you’re designing a UI and forget how to set up a RecyclerView, you can ask Gemini for a starter template. It also works with Android’s layout editor, offering suggestions for XML views and constraints. Debugging becomes less painful too—Gemini can analyze your stack traces and point you toward the root cause.
How to Enable Gemini in Android Studio
The best part? It’s free as part of Android Studio. To get started, open your project, look for the Gemini icon in the toolbar, or press a simple keyboard shortcut. Once activated, a chat panel opens on the side where you can type questions or commands. The assistant will respond with code blocks, explanations, or step-by-step guides. IBM watsonx Code Assistant
While many top ai coding tools aim to help individual developers, IBM watsonx Code Assistant is built for a different scale entirely. It’s designed for large enterprises that need AI-generated code recommendations tailored to specific, complex platforms. Instead of a one-size-fits-all assistant, IBM offers separate products for two key environments: Red Hat Ansible and IBM Z. The Ansible-focused tool helps you write automation playbooks faster, which is a big win if your team manages infrastructure at scale. The Z product, on the other hand, targets mainframe modernization — a niche but critical area where legacy code meets AI assistance.
For any business considering enterprise AI coding, governance and security are non-negotiable. IBM watsonx Code Assistant includes robust features to keep your code compliant and your data safe, which is essential in regulated industries. Pricing is tailored to enterprise agreements, so you’ll need to contact IBM for specifics. If your organization relies on Red Hat Ansible automation or maintains mainframe systems, this tool could save your teams significant time while reducing errors — all within a controlled, enterprise-grade environment.

Cursor
If you’re already comfortable in Visual Studio Code, Cursor feels like a natural upgrade—it’s an AI‑first code editor built on top of it. That means you keep all your existing VS Code extensions, themes, and keybindings while gaining deep AI integration directly inside the editor. Unlike a separate chat window, Cursor’s features are embedded into your workflow. For example, you can ask it to generate a block of code, refactor a messy function, or even explain a line you’re unsure about—all without leaving your file. This tight integration makes it one of the top AI coding tools for developers who want to speed up daily tasks without switching tools.
What sets Cursor apart is how it handles AI code refactoring and multi-line edits. Instead of copying code to a chatbot, you highlight a section, press a shortcut, and describe the change you want. The editor applies it inline, so you can review and accept immediately. Its VS Code AI integration also extends to project-level understanding—it can suggest changes across several files when you’re restructuring code. Getting started is straightforward: there’s a free tier for personal use, plus paid plans if you need more AI queries or team features. For an editor that pairs familiar VS Code shortcuts with intelligent assistance, Cursor is a practical, time-saving choice.
Sourcegraph Cody
If you work on large, complex projects, keeping track of every file and function can be a challenge. That’s where Cody comes in. Unlike some assistants that only see the code you have open, Cody by Sourcegraph acts as a codebase AI assistant. It understands the full context of your entire repository, which means it can answer questions about code you haven’t looked at in months. For example, you can ask it to explain a legacy function, suggest how to refactor a module, or generate new code that fits neatly into your existing architecture. This deep code understanding AI makes Cody especially valuable for code exploration and debugging across large teams.
You can use Cody directly inside your editor. It supports popular environments like VS Code and JetBrains IDEs, so you don’t have to switch tools to get help. The assistant provides AI‑powered code explanations, refactoring suggestions, and generation that respects your project’s style. For individuals, the free tier is a great way to start exploring your codebase with AI. If you need more advanced features or want to roll it out across your team, Sourcegraph offers team and enterprise plans. For anyone managing a sizable codebase, Cody is a practical, context-aware addition to your set of top AI coding tools.

How do AI coding assistants learn to generate code?
They are trained on vast collections of public code repositories, learning patterns, syntax, and common programming practices. This allows them to predict and suggest the next lines of code based on your current context. The models use deep learning to understand natural language prompts and convert them into functional code snippets.
